From 0c4ef1f4058b60d6898db2128c31d6df568de93a Mon Sep 17 00:00:00 2001 From: Evgenii Kozlov Date: Fri, 28 Feb 2025 17:46:54 +0100 Subject: [PATCH] DROID-2893 Space-level chat | Fix | Fix reaction limit UX --- .../anytype/feature_chats/ui/ChatBubble.kt | 28 ++++++++++--------- 1 file changed, 15 insertions(+), 13 deletions(-) diff --git a/feature-chats/src/main/java/com/anytypeio/anytype/feature_chats/ui/ChatBubble.kt b/feature-chats/src/main/java/com/anytypeio/anytype/feature_chats/ui/ChatBubble.kt index d1a1ed1a7b..c6050c30ad 100644 --- a/feature-chats/src/main/java/com/anytypeio/anytype/feature_chats/ui/ChatBubble.kt +++ b/feature-chats/src/main/java/com/anytypeio/anytype/feature_chats/ui/ChatBubble.kt @@ -298,19 +298,21 @@ fun Bubble( showDropdownMenu = false } ) { - DropdownMenuItem( - text = { - Text( - text = stringResource(R.string.chats_add_reaction), - color = colorResource(id = R.color.text_primary), - modifier = Modifier.padding(end = 64.dp) - ) - }, - onClick = { - onAddReactionClicked() - showDropdownMenu = false - } - ) + if (!isMaxReactionCountReached) { + DropdownMenuItem( + text = { + Text( + text = stringResource(R.string.chats_add_reaction), + color = colorResource(id = R.color.text_primary), + modifier = Modifier.padding(end = 64.dp) + ) + }, + onClick = { + onAddReactionClicked() + showDropdownMenu = false + } + ) + } Divider(paddingStart = 0.dp, paddingEnd = 0.dp) DropdownMenuItem( text = {